What does an emergency preparedness manager do?
An emergency preparedness manager plans the response in the event of an emergency. Your duties in this position include performing research and coming up with a strategy to deal with different types of disasters. You may help coordinate the response of various agencies and share your plan with each group to ensure proper preparation. Your responsibilities include evaluating your strategies by performing drills. You then change emergency protocols if necessary. Other duties include making arrangements for the communications, supplies, and equipment required for the response effort. As an emergency preparedness manager, you also help coordinate operations in the event of an actual emergency.

What is the difference between Emergency Preparedness Manager vs Emergency Response Coordinator?
| Aspect | Emergency Preparedness Manager | Emergency Response Coordinator |
|---|---|---|
| Certifications | FEMA certifications, CPR, first aid | FEMA certifications, CPR, first aid |
| Work Environment | Planning, training, policy development | On-site response, incident management |
| Employer & Industry | Corporations, government agencies, healthcare | Emergency services, government agencies |
While both roles focus on safety and emergency management, the Emergency Preparedness Manager primarily develops plans, conducts training, and prepares organizations for potential emergencies. In contrast, the Emergency Response Coordinator is more involved in immediate incident response and on-the-ground management during emergencies.

Context of the Job:
The Director of College Facilities Planning serves as a member of the College of Engineering Business Office Management Team which works as a cohesive unit within the College to ensure effective overall college administrative management. Under limited direction of the Chief Financial and Administrative Officer, the Director of College Facilities Planning is responsible for the efficient and effective planning and needed renovation of College-wide Facilities. Actively participates in strategic planning and decision making as part of the College business administrative leadership team. The Director of College Facilities Planning represents the College of Engineering and is the principle liaison with UD Facilities Project Planning & Delivery (PPD), Facilities Maintenance & Operations, Custodial Services, Public Safety, and Environmental Health and Safety. This position also coordinates the maintenance, custodial services, construction, safety, and emergency preparedness of the College of Engineering's facilities which total approximately 332,000 square feet of combined UD campus and leased space. The College of Engineering has a presence in approximately 20 different on and off campus buildings including the Harker Lab, Delaware Technology Park, and the STAR campus.
Major Responsibilities:
- Direct, guide and anticipate issues regarding facilities management of the College of Engineering which consists of approximately $12M annually to provide for the operation, maintenance, safety, and emergency preparedness of the College of Engineering facilities.
- Provide counsel to the Chief Financial and Administrative Officer and College Business Office Teams on matters of Facilities Planning and Renovation.
- Assist in the creation of an annual facilities budget; manage annual facilities budget; perform variable cost analyses to make financial projections.
- Lead the College of Engineering Facilities Team; Directly manage Assistant Director of Engineering Facilities Planning, and four master machinists, while maintaining a functional relationship with 10 departmental laboratory coordinators and electronics technicians.
- Leverage the technical knowledge, mechanical skills, safety training, space planning, project management, and communication strengths of each member to serve inter-departmental needs or to take on College-wide projects/initiatives.
- Hold monthly meetings to review the progress of all ongoing renovation projects, brainstorm solutions to maintenance/infrastructure issues, and discuss space utilization solutions.
- Represent the College of Engineering throughout the planning, construction, and turnover of all newly built or renovated space on and off campus.
- Review and interpret proposed designs, architectural drawings, and building specifications for appropriateness to required functions and/or institutional standards, and requests revisions where appropriate.
- Participate in the planning and formulation of design alternatives and solutions for major construction projects.
- Direct renovation and fit out of highly sophisticated laboratories.
- Review and approve all design and construction budgets.
- Manage the acquisition, management, maintenance, and modification of leased spaces; direct complex lease arrangements; oversee the related fit-out, utilities, design and equipment purchases.
- Provide recommendations to ensure the CoE facilities are being utilized as effectively and efficiently as possible.
- Serve as key staff member of the College of Engineering Space Planning Committee which computes proper allocation of space and settles disputes as well as plans for future needs related to College growth in faculty and student enrollment.
- Identifies suitable space on and off campus to renovate for research, administration, instruction, computer operations, and student organizations, etc. Assess the renovation requirements versus the strategic benefits of utilizing various space options for different College as well as University-wide initiatives.
- Oversee the day-to-day updating by a staff member of the College of Engineering's own space database via online forms submitted by COE departments for occupancy changes, the re-purposing of existing space, and requests for additional space; request specific query reports as needed for space analysis and strategic space planning. Oversee the updating of architectural layouts of College of Engineering space with occupancy information.
- Coordinate with the Chief Administrative Officers of A&S and LCBE regarding management of shared leased space.
- Manage college information conveyed in the annual UD-wide space survey; provide space verification and capital equipment reports for all College of Engineering facilities.
- Ensure the effective maintenance, cleanliness, operation, and security of the physical plant, the offices, conference rooms, open space, and the teaching and research laboratories of the College of Engineering in a safe and environmentally sound manner; act as the principle liaison with UD Facilities Department, UD Environmental Health and Safety, UD Custodial, and UD Public Safety to accomplish these goals.
- Meet with the Directors of Facilities PPD and M&O on a monthly basis to review the progress of all ongoing COE renovation projects, discuss solutions to building defects and maintenance issues, and prioritize the needed next steps to move toward completion of our goals.
- Work with Facilities M&O Engineering group to seek resolutions to defective infrastructure systems such as process chilled water, compressed air, fume hood ventilation, insufficient outside air, etc. Champion the effort to determine the root cause of the defect; collaborate with Facilities M&O and outside consultants to identify solutions; lobby to implement the best solution.
- Coordinate with Facilities IT to ensure that accurate electronic card access information for COE buildings is imported on a daily and monthly basis into ProWatch from various sources.
- Serve as a College of Engineering representative on the University Chemical Hygiene Committee that sets University safety standards; meet with EHS on a frequent basis to review safety concerns as they continually present themselves within a research environment; ensure that all staff receive annual OSHA Right-to-Know training.
- Coordinate with UD Public Safety and Parking Services to activate temporary traffic pattern and parking space modifications as needed for special events.
- Pursue and manage corporate donations of material assets such as furnishings, laboratory equipment, and laboratory casework for re-deployment within the College of Engineering.
- Optimize the use of lab and office furniture across the College by overseeing the management of a communal spare furniture storage area.
- Direct, supervise, and provide leadership to exempt and non-exempt staff as appropriate to ensure performance consistent with University and College policies and procedures.
- Perform miscellaneous job-related duties as assigned.
